Caserta. “The ZTL in San Leucio and Vaccheria will start in June”

Article published on: 05/20/2024 13:35:03


This is the press release issued by the Municipality of Caserta: “The Ztl (limited traffic zone) in San Leucio and Vaccheria will start in June. A gate will be located in Via Vaccheria in San Leucio, at number 35, that is – yes law – in the immediate vicinity of the climb that leads to the San Leucio Belvedere. It will be active until mid-October, every day, from 7pm to 6am the following morning. Always in the same period, every day, from 7pm to 6am the following day, the Ztl will be active in the passage of Via Cappuccio, or at the access door to the Vaccheria, the road that leads to Piazza Madonna delle Grazie.

Another passage is that of Via Antonio Planelli, which is the road – he continues – which in San Leucio connects Piazza della Seta to the Monumental Staircase of the Belvedere. The gate will be active until August 31st on Saturdays, Sundays and public holidays during the week, from 8pm to 3am. In the event of events scheduled at the Belvedere di San Leucio, the Municipality reserves the right to activate the gate, allowing passage only to vehicles authorized by the Local Police.

All those who intend to request access to the Ztl can fill out the form on the website of the Municipality of Caserta, at the following link: https://www.comune.caserta.it/archivio10_notizie_0_3801.html.

“This is – explained the Mayor of Caserta, Carlo Marino – a measure that is part of a vast program that envisages the creation of an increasingly green city that is in step with the times. On the mobility front, a real revolution is underway: we have completely renovated and eco-sustainable local public transport, we are creating 18 km of cycle paths and making many ecological means of transport available to citizens, thanks to the ‘Smart City’ project. We are investing a lot and, within a few years, we will complete a major modernization process.”

“This measure – added the Deputy Mayor and Councilor for Mobility, Emiliano Casale – constitutes a further step in the sustainable mobility project. We have installed scooters throughout the city, electric charging platforms, 52 new e-bikes, battery-powered scooters and another 30 charging stations for electric vehicles are on the way. In addition to all this, we will also soon install cameras, which will ensure safety, as well as prevent accidents. We are implementing an exceptional program, which will help to completely transform our city’s mobility system.”

“For San Leucio and Vaccheria – declared the municipal councilor delegated for the area, Donato Tenga – it is a very important provision, which comes at the end of a fruitful discussion that took place in recent months with the residents, at the end of which we accepted their requests . The inhabitants of these two historic districts of the city have the right to rest and tranquility and the establishment of the Ztl will also be very useful for protecting these magnificent places, which constitute a fundamental part of the artistic-cultural heritage of our community””.
